Durban — The new Chinese leadership under President Xi Jinping has told Prime Minister Manmohan Singh it will continue to pursue the positive groundwork laid down by its predecessors to improve ties between the two Asian neighbors, notwithstanding the long-pending border dispute.
This was the outcome of two significant meetings Xi had with Prime Minister Manmohan Singh, one on the margins of the BRICS Summit Wednesday and the other a more structured two-way engagement hours later.

WASHINGTON: US President Barack Obama has appointed veteran agent Julia Pierson as the new director of the Secret Service, making her the first female to head the elite commando unit responsible for the security of the first family.

RAJKOT: They were the most eligible bachelors in their village. Then drought struck Dedan village near Amreli and the same men suddenly turned unfit for marriage. The water crisis here has effectively extended their bachelorhood.
